Concrete driveway installation involves preparing the site, pouring, and finishing a durable concrete surface that serves as a practical and lasting entrance to a property. The process typically begins with site assessment and preparation, including grading and compacting the ground to ensure proper drainage and stability. Once the foundation is ready, seasoned contractors pour the concrete into forms, level it, and apply finishing techniques to create a smooth, even surface. Depending on the property and homeowner preferences, contractors can incorporate various finishes, patterns, or textures to enhance the driveway’s appearance and functionality.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Driveway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Minor crack repairs or patching typically cost between $250 and $600 for many routine jobs. Most local contractors handle these smaller projects within this range, though prices can vary based on the extent of damage.

Basic Driveway Installation - Installing a new concrete driveway usually falls within $3,000 to $7,000 for standard-sized projects. Many homeowners fall into this middle range, with larger or more complex installations reaching higher costs.

Custom Designs and Finishes - Adding decorative finishes or custom patterns can increase costs to $8,000 or more, depending on complexity. These projects are less common but can significantly enhance curb appeal when chosen by homeowners.

Full Replacement or Large-Scale Projects - Complete driveway replacements or extensive projects often range from $10,000 to $20,000+ for larger, more intricate jobs. While fewer projects fall into this highest tier, local contractors can handle these larger-scale installations.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of choosing a concrete driveway? Concrete driveways are durable, low-maintenance, and can enhance the curb appeal of a property, making them a popular choice for many homeowners.

How do local contractors prepare for a driveway installation? Contractors typically assess the site, ensure proper grading, and prepare a solid foundation to ensure the longevity and stability of the concrete driveway.

What types of finishes are available for concrete driveways? There are various finishes such as stamped, exposed aggregate, broomed, and colored concrete, allowing customization to match aesthetic preferences.

Can a concrete driveway be built on an existing driveway? Yes, in some cases, contractors can remove or overlay existing driveways, but assessment by local service providers is recommended to determine the best approach.

What maintenance is required for a concrete driveway? Routine cleaning and sealing are typically sufficient to maintain the appearance and durability of a concrete driveway over time.
